Ukraine boosts sunflower oil output by 20.2% in 2016 – statistics agency

Ukraine produced 4.4 million tonnes of crude sunflower oil in 2016, which was 20.2% up on 2015, according to the country's State Statistics Service.

In December 2016 alone, it produced 557,000 tonnes of sunflower oil, which was 5.3% up on the previous month and 47.8% up year-over-year.

However, production of margarine and edible fat shrank by 13.6% last year from 2015, to 184,000 tonnes, the statistics agency said.

The statistical report does not cover data from such temporarily occupied territory as the Crimean peninsula and the city of Sevastopol, and the zone in the east of Ukraine where the Anti-Terrorist Operation is under way.

Ukraine is among the world's largest exporters of sunflower oil. In 2016, sunflower oil exports from Ukraine totaled 4.8 million tonnes, which was 23% up on 2015, the Ukroliyaprom Association reported.

Sunflower oil shipments abroad in monetary terms were estimated at US$4.8 billion against US$4.2 billion in 2015.
